Seminars

 

Each year, the KCRFTHA hosts various seminars.  Seminars topics vary from educational seminars to riding clinics.  Typically, seminars are open to anyone that would like to attend; however, there may be a small charge for non-KCRFTHA members.  Below is the schedule for upcoming KCRFTHA seminars.

 
When:  February 18, 2012

Time:  9:30 a.m., registration at 8:45 a.m.

Morning Session Topic:  The Unique Aspects of Shoeing the Missouri Fox Trotting Horse, presented by Mark Holifield

Topics will include:

  • How hoof angles impact gait

  • Hoof and leg conformation issues

  • How shoeing a Missouri Fox Trotter is different from a stock horse

  • Shoeing Q&A

Afternoon Session Topic: Refining the Gaits of the Missouri Fox Trotter, presented by David Ogle

Topics will include:

  • How headset and bitting influences gait

  • General gait discussion of the flat walk, fox trot and canter

  • Gait training Q&A

Location:  The Family Center, Mill-Walk Mall, 2601 Cantrell Road, Harrisonville, MO 64701    Click HERE to view Map.

Notes:   Seminar is FREE for KCRFTHA members.  Non-members are welcome.  $10/person, fee includes an optional free membership in the KCRFTHA.  Youth 17 and under are free with an adult.  Chili lunch provided.  Attendees will be entered in drawing for various door prizes.
